PHP ဘာသာစကား၏စဉ်ဆက်မပြတ်တိုးတက်မှုနှင့်အတူလုပ်ဆောင်မှုစွမ်းဆောင်ရည် optimization သည်လျှောက်လွှာကိုတိုးတက်စေရန်အတွက်အဓိကနည်းလမ်းဖြစ်လာသည်။ ဤဆောင်းပါးသည် PHP လုပ်ဆောင်ချက်များကိုအကောင်အထည်ဖော်မှုမြန်နှုန်းနှင့်တုန့်ပြန်မှုများကိုထိရောက်စွာတိုးတက်စေရန်ထိရောက်စွာလုပ်ဆောင်ရန်အတွက်ဖြတ်တောက်သောအစွန်းများနှင့်မဟာဗျူဟာများကိုမိတ်ဆက်ပေးလိမ့်မည်။
လက်ငင်းစုစည်းခြင်း (JIT) သည် PHP ကုဒ်ကို dynamically ကိုစက်ကုဒ်သို့ပြောင်းလဲခြင်း, ဘာသာပြန်ဆိုခြင်း၏ overhead ကိုလျှော့ချပေးသည်။ PHP 8.0 ကတည်းက JIT Support သည်အထူးသဖြင့်တွက်ချက်မှုအထူးသဖြင့်တွက်ချက်မှုဆိုင်ရာအပြင်းအထန်လုပ်ဆောင်မှုများကိုသိသိသာသာတိုးတက်လာသည်။
Proloading Technetice နည်းပညာသည်ပရိုဂရမ် Startup Precount တွင်အသုံးများသောလုပ်ငန်းများကိုမှတ်ဉာဏ်ထဲသို့ 0 င်ရောက်ခွင့်ပြုသည်။ OPCICE.PRELOAD ကိုပြုပြင်ခြင်းအားဖြင့် developer များသိသိသာသာတိုကျခိုကျမှု၏ခေါ်ဆိုမှုအချိန်ကိုသိသိသာသာတိုစေခြင်းနှင့် applications များ၏ startup နှင့်စစ်ဆင်ရေးထိရောက်မှုကိုတိုးတက်စေရန်။
သင့်လျော်သောဒေတာဖွဲ့စည်းပုံကိုရွေးချယ်ခြင်းသည် function စွမ်းဆောင်ရည်အပေါ်တိုက်ရိုက်သက်ရောက်မှုရှိသည်။ မလိုအပ်သောအချက်အလက်များကိုကူးယူခြင်းနှင့်မှတ်ဉာဏ်ခွဲဝေချထားခြင်းများကိုရှောင်ကြဉ်ပါ။
ကြိမ်နှုန်းမြင့်မားသောအခြေအနေများတွင် cache သည်စွမ်းဆောင်ရည်တိုးတက်စေရန်အတွက်ထိရောက်သောနည်းလမ်းဖြစ်သည်။ ဥပမာ Database Query Resault ရလဒ်များသိုလှောင်ရန်နောက်ဆက်တွဲလက်လှမ်းမီမှုသည် Cache ကိုတိုက်ရိုက်ဖတ်ရှုနိုင်ပါသည်။
JIT စုစည်းခြင်းနှင့်အတူပေါင်းစပ်ခြင်း, Preload functions and data ဖွဲ့စည်းပုံ optimization, PHP function စွမ်းဆောင်ရည်သိသိသာသာတိုးတက်လာလိမ့်မည်။ ဆင်ခြင်နစ်မြုပ်ခြင်းကဲ့သို့သောလက်တွေ့ကျတဲ့နည်းပညာများကိုအသုံးပြုခြင်းသည်လျှောက်လွှာတုံ့ပြန်မှုမြန်နှုန်းနှင့်အရင်းအမြစ်အသုံးချမှုကိုပိုမိုကောင်းမွန်စေနိုင်သည်။